Prepare pci device for system-wide transition into a sleep state
int pci_prepare_to_sleep(struct pci_dev * dev);
dev
Device to handle.
Choose the power state appropriate for the device depending on whether it can wake up the system and/or is power manageable by the platform (PCI_D3hot is the default) and put the device into that state.